Case study - LS21

Ant Trail Into an Otley Kitchen

Ant activity was entering through a patio-side kitchen edge and returning after repeated cleaning.

Property

Stone-built home with kitchen access from a patio edge.

How they found us

Google search after daily ant trails kept returning.

Ant control inspection around an Otley kitchen threshold

The Problem

  • A visible trail appeared along the kitchen skirting each morning.
  • Cleaning removed the trail temporarily, but activity returned.
  • The customer was worried about food storage areas.

What I Found

  • Trail activity entering from the patio-side wall.
  • A likely nest route outside rather than a kitchen-source issue.
  • Small access gaps around the skirting and threshold.

What I Did

  • Tracked the trail direction inside and outside.
  • Applied targeted treatment to the active route.
  • Advised on food storage and cleaning during treatment.
  • Highlighted small access points for future sealing.

Timeline

Day 1

Trail tracing and treatment.

Day 3

Activity reduced heavily around the skirting.

Day 7

No daily trail pattern reported.

Outcome

  • The kitchen was usable without repeated morning cleaning.
  • The treatment targeted the route, not just the visible ants.
  • The customer had practical prevention steps for the patio edge.

Evidence Recorded

  • Kitchen trail line.
  • Patio-side access route.
  • Skirting and threshold gaps.
